OBJECTIVE: Different definitions have been used for screening for rheumatic heart disease (RHD). This led to the development of the 2012 evidence-based World Heart Federation (WHF) echocardiographic criteria. The objective of this study is to determine the intra-rater and inter-rater reliability and agreement in differentiating no RHD from mild RHD using the WHF echocardiographic criteria. METHODS: A standard set of 200 echocardiograms was collated from prior population-based surveys and uploaded for blinded web-based reporting. Fifteen international cardiologists reported on and categorised each echocardiogram as no RHD, borderline or definite RHD. Intra-rater and inter-rater reliability was calculated using Cohen's and Fleiss' free-marginal multirater kappa (κ) statistics, respectively. Agreement assessment was expressed as percentages. Subanalyses assessed reproducibility and agreement parameters in detecting individual components of WHF criteria. RESULTS: Sample size from a statistical standpoint was 3000, based on repeated reporting of the 200 studies. The inter-rater and intra-rater reliability of diagnosing definite RHD was substantial with a kappa of 0.65 and 0.69, respectively. The diagnosis of pathological mitral and aortic regurgitation was reliable and almost perfect, kappa of 0.79 and 0.86, respectively. Agreement for morphological changes of RHD was variable ranging from 0.54 to 0.93 κ. CONCLUSIONS: The WHF echocardiographic criteria enable reproducible categorisation of echocardiograms as definite RHD versus no or borderline RHD and hence it would be a suitable tool for screening and monitoring disease progression. The study highlights the strengths and limitations of the WHF echo criteria and provides a platform for future revisions.

BACKGROUND: Pre-participation cardiovascular evaluation (PPE) aims to detect cardiac disease with sudden cardiac death (SCD) risk. No study has focused on Pacific Island athletes. METHODS: A total of 2281 Pacific Island athletes were studied with (i) a questionnaire on family, personal history and symptoms, (ii) a physical examination and (iii) a 12-lead ECG. RESULTS: 85% presented a normal history and examination. A positive family history was 1.4-1.9 fold higher in Melanesians, Polynesians and Métis than in Caucasians, while a positive personal history, abnormal symptoms and abnormal examination was 1.3 fold higher in Melanesians and Métis than in others. Neither gender nor training level had a bearing on these results. Melanesians had higher T wave inversions (TWIs) in V2-V4 leads but had no CV abnormalities. Lateral or infero-lateral TWIs were found in 6 male and in 5 highly trained athletes and cardiomyopathies were diagnosed in 3/6 athletes. Overall, 3.9% athletes were found to have a CV abnormality and 0.8% had a risk of SCD. Polynesians and males were more at risk than the others while the level of training made no difference. In athletes at risk of SCD, the main detected CV diseases were cardiomyopathies, Wolff-Parkinson-White (WPW) and severe valve lesions of rheumatoid origin. CONCLUSIONS: PPE revealed that 3.9% presented CV abnormalities. A risk of SCD was found in 0.8% with cardiomyopathies, WPW, and severe valve lesions of rheumatoid origin. Melanesians, Polynesians and male of high level of training were more at risk than others.

The objective of this study was to determine iodine nutrition status and whether iodine status differs across salt intake levels among a sample of women aged 18-45 years living in Samoa. A cross-sectional survey was completed and 24-hr urine samples were collected and assessed for iodine (n=152) and salt excretion (n=119). The median urinary iodine concentration (UIC) among the women was 88 µg/L (Interquartile range (IQR)=54-121 µg/L). 62% of the women had a UIC <100 µg/L. The crude estimated mean 24-hr urinary salt excretion was 6.6 (standard deviation 3.2) g/day. More than two-thirds (66%) of the women exceeded the World Health Organization recommended maximum level of 5 g/day. No association was found between median UIC and salt excretion (81 µg/L iodine where urinary salt excretion >=5 g/day versus 76 µg/L where urinary salt excretion <5 g/day; p=0.4). Iodine nutrition appears to be insufficient in this population and may be indicative of iodine deficiency disorders in Samoan women. A collaborative approach in monitoring iodine status and salt intake will strengthen both programs and greatly inform the level of iodine fortification required to ensure optimal iodine intake as population salt reduction programs take effect.

This project measured population salt intake in Samoa by integrating urinary sodium analysis into the World Health Organization's (WHO's) STEPwise approach to surveillance of noncommunicable disease risk factors (STEPS). A subsample of the Samoan Ministry of Health's 2013 STEPS Survey collected 24-hour and spot urine samples and completed questions on salt-related behaviors. Complete urine samples were available for 293 participants. Overall, weighted mean population 24-hour urine excretion of salt was 7.09 g (standard error 0.19) to 7.63 g (standard error 0.27) for men and 6.39 g (standard error 0.14) for women (P=.0014). Salt intake increased with body mass index (P=.0004), and people who added salt at the table had 1.5 g higher salt intakes than those who did not add salt (P=.0422). A total of 70% of the population had urinary excretion values above the 5 g/d cutoff recommended by the WHO. A reduction of 30% (2 g) would reduce average population salt intake to 5 g/d, in line with WHO recommendations. While challenging, integration of salt monitoring into STEPS provides clear logistical and cost benefits and the lessons communicated here can help inform future programs.

BACKGROUND: There is broad consensus that diets high in salt are bad for health and that reducing salt intake is a cost-effective strategy for preventing chronic diseases. The World Health Organization has been supporting the development of salt reduction strategies in the Pacific Islands where salt intakes are thought to be high. However, there are no accurate measures of salt intake in these countries. The aims of this project are to establish baseline levels of salt intake in two Pacific Island countries, implement multi-pronged, cross-sectoral salt reduction programs in both, and determine the effects and cost-effectiveness of the intervention strategies. METHODS/DESIGN: Intervention effectiveness will be assessed from cross-sectional surveys before and after population-based salt reduction interventions in Fiji and Samoa. Baseline surveys began in July 2012 and follow-up surveys will be completed by July 2015 after a 2-year intervention period.A three-stage stratified cluster random sampling strategy will be used for the population surveys, building on existing government surveys in each country. Data on salt intake, salt levels in foods and sources of dietary salt measured at baseline will be combined with an in-depth qualitative analysis of stakeholder views to develop and implement targeted interventions to reduce salt intake. DISCUSSION: Salt reduction is a global priority and all Member States of the World Health Organization have agreed on a target to reduce salt intake by 30% by 2025, as part of the global action plan to reduce the burden of non-communicable diseases. The study described by this protocol will be the first to provide a robust assessment of salt intake and the impact of salt reduction interventions in the Pacific Islands. As such, it will inform the development of strategies for other Pacific Island countries and comparable low and middle-income settings around the world.

AIM: To compare the prevalence of metabolic syndrome (MetS) by combinations of MetS components derived from the National Cholesterol Education Program Adult Treatment Panel III (ATPIII) and International Diabetes Federation (IDF) definitions. METHODS: Four studies with ethnically distinct populations from the Asia-Pacific region were selected from the DETECT-2 study database. The prevalences of combinations of MetS components using the modified ATPIII (modATPIII) and IDF MetS definitions were compared between sexes and across populations. RESULTS: A total of 22,952 participants from Australia, Japan, Korea and Samoa were included. The age-adjusted prevalence of modATPIII MetS varied from 9.4 to 35.8% in men and 10.3 to 57.2% in women; results for IDF were generally higher. Prevalences of the 16 possible MetS component combinations from the modATPIII definition that result in a diagnosis of MetS ranged from 0 to 12.7%. Of those with IDF-defined abdominal obesity, the prevalences of the 11 IDF-defined MetS component combinations ranged from 0.2 to 18.3%. CONCLUSIONS: The large variation in the prevalence of possible MetS component combinations to diagnose MetS may explain the different risk of cardiovascular outcomes associated with MetS in different populations, especially since particular combinations of MetS components are associated with different risk of cardiovascular disease.

BACKGROUND: To compare the prevalence of metabolic syndrome (MetS) by four MetS definitions in four Asia-Pacific populations, and to compare the prevalence of individual metabolic components. METHODS: Population-based cross-sectional studies from Australia, Japan, Korea, and Samoa were used to assess the World Health Organization (WHO), European Group for the Study of Insulin Resistance (EGIR), modified National Cholesterol Education Program Adult Treatment Panel III (modATPIII), and International Diabetes Federation (IDF) MetS definitions. Age-adjusted MetS prevalences were compared within and between countries and kappa statistics were used to determine the agreement between IDF and the other three definitions. RESULTS: Japanese people had the lowest prevalence of MetS regardless of definition, and Samoans generally the highest prevalence. Age-adjusted prevalences for the four definitions ranged from 16% to 42% in Australia, 3% to 11% in Japan, 7% to 29% in Korea and 17% to 60% in Samoa. With the exceptions of Korean and Japanese males, the highest prevalence of MetS was obtained with the IDF definition. The best overall agreement with IDF MetS definition was for modATPIII, and the worst for EGIR. There were marked differences in the prevalence of MetS between the sexes, with no systematic pattern, and between the prevalences of individual metabolic components. CONCLUSIONS: Differences in the prevalence of MetS and its components, using the various definitions, both within and between populations, indicate that caution is required when comparing studies from different countries. Determining the clinical significance of these differences will require prospective outcome studies.
